Output 508c23c20af494d1f1f83f1d0a960055d25d396fe3bae6ece19adff4685a6d3f:0

value
989666
script pubkey
OP_0 OP_PUSHBYTES_20 875513ad3344f0f6a93b61ab78bd9645187987dd
address
bc1qsa238tfngnc0d2fmvx4h30vkg5v8np7aks7p5n
transaction
508c23c20af494d1f1f83f1d0a960055d25d396fe3bae6ece19adff4685a6d3f
spent
true